Key Factors Influencing Basement Costs

  • Labor Costs (35-50% of total): Vary significantly by region and contractor expertise
  • Material Selection: From budget drywall ($1.50/sq ft) to premium finishes ($15+/sq ft)
  • Basement Condition: Moisture issues, ceiling height, and existing infrastructure
  • Local Building Codes: Egress window requirements, insulation standards, and permit costs
  • Project Scope: Simple finishing vs. complete remodel with bathrooms and kitchens

2026 Basement Cost Breakdown Per Square Foot

Project Type Cost Per Sq Ft (Low) Cost Per Sq Ft (High) Average Total (1,000 sq ft) Key Inclusions
Basic Finishing $30 $50 $40,000 Framing, drywall, basic electrical, flooring, paint
Mid-Range Renovation $50 $75 $62,500 Above + bathroom rough-in, better finishes, lighting
High-End Remodel $75 $120 $97,500 Full bathroom, kitchenette, premium flooring, custom features
Luxury Conversion $120 $200+ $160,000+ Wet bar, home theater, spa bathroom, high-end materials
Unfinished Basement Prep $8 $15 $11,500 Moisture sealing, insulation, basic electrical/plumbing rough-ins

Regional Cost Variations (2026)

Northeast & West Coast: Highest costs at $75-$150 per square foot due to labor rates and building codes

Midwest: Most affordable at $30-$65 per square foot with competitive contractor markets

South: Mid-range pricing $40-$80 per square foot, varying by urban vs. rural locations

Mountain States: $45-$90 per square foot with premium for remote locations

Critical Budget Consideration

Always allocate 15-20% of your total basement cost per square foot budget for unexpected issues like moisture remediation, structural adjustments, or code compliance upgrades discovered during renovation.

Hidden Costs Often Overlooked

  1. Permit Fees: $500-$2,000 depending on municipality
  2. Egress Window Installation: $2,500-$5,500 per window
  3. Moisture/Mold Remediation: $1,500-$5,000+ if issues discovered
  4. HVAC Extension: $3,000-$7,000 for proper basement climate control
  5. Professional Design Fees: $1,500-$5,000 for architectural plans

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What is the average basement cost per square foot in 2026?

The average basement finishing cost per square foot ranges from $30-$75, with most homeowners spending $50-$60 per square foot for a mid-range renovation. Luxury conversions can exceed $120 per square foot.

How much does it cost to finish a 1,000 sq ft basement?

Finishing a 1,000 square foot basement typically costs between $30,000 and $75,000 in 2026, with an average of $50,000-$60,000 for quality materials and professional installation.

Does basement cost per square foot include bathroom installation?

Basic basement cost per square foot estimates usually don't include full bathrooms. Adding a bathroom increases costs by $8,000-$25,000 depending on fixtures and complexity.

How does location affect basement renovation costs?

Location impacts costs by 30-50%. Urban areas and regions with higher labor rates (Northeast, West Coast) have higher cost per square foot to finish basement projects compared to Midwest and Southern states.

Can I reduce basement costs with DIY work?

Homeowners can save 20-30% on basement remodel cost per square foot by handling painting, flooring installation, or trim work themselves. However, electrical, plumbing, and structural work should remain with professionals.

How long does a basement renovation take?

A typical 1,000 sq ft basement renovation takes 4-8 weeks. Complex projects with bathrooms or kitchenettes may require 10-12 weeks. Proper planning reduces timeline overruns.

What adds the most value to a basement renovation?

Adding a bathroom (70-85% ROI), creating a legal bedroom with egress (65-80% ROI), and installing quality flooring offer the best return on your basement renovation cost per square foot investment.

Quick Cost Reference
  • Basic Framing $4-8/sq ft
  • Drywall Installation $2-4/sq ft
  • Electrical Work $3-6/sq ft
  • Flooring Installation $3-15/sq ft
  • Bathroom Addition $8-25k
  • Moisture Proofing $3-7/sq ft
